    The Local Pack Is Everything

    Most business owners fixate on ranking number one on Google. But the real prize is something different – the local pack. That cluster of business listings appearing beneath the map generates a disproportionate share of clicks compared to everything listed below it. Businesses that crack the local pack on high-intent searches are not just getting traffic. They are getting phone calls from people who are ready to spend. Miss that section entirely and even a beautifully designed website sits largely invisible.

    Reviews Do the Ranking Work

    Many Gold Coast businesses treat Google reviews as a vanity metric. That is a costly misunderstanding. Search algorithms actively use review velocity, recency, and the language inside reviews to determine local rankings. A plumber in Burleigh Heads with recent reviews mentioning “hot water system” and “emergency callout” will surface for those exact searches far more reliably than a competitor with older reviews that say nothing specific. Encouraging customers to describe the actual service in their review is not just good for reputation. It is genuine SEO strategy.

    Your Competitors Are Leaving Gaps

    Gold Coast suburbs each carry distinct search behaviour. Surfers Paradise queries skew heavily towards tourist-facing services and short-term needs. Robina and Varsity Lakes lean towards professional services and longer-term relationships. Coolangatta has a different demographic rhythm entirely. Businesses that create suburb-specific content – not spammy doorway pages, but genuinely useful localised information – exploit gaps that most competitors leave wide open. Most simply avoid it because producing that content feels tedious and unglamorous.

    Website Speed Kills Conversions Silently

    A slow-loading website on mobile does not just frustrate visitors. It actively suppresses rankings. Small business SEO in Gold Coast is particularly vulnerable to this because many local businesses built their websites years ago on platforms never designed with mobile performance in mind. Google’s Core Web Vitals are a direct ranking signal. A site scoring poorly on loading speed, visual stability, and interactivity gets penalised in ways most business owners never realise. Nobody tells them. The traffic just quietly disappears.

    Content Strategy Versus Content Volume

    Pumping out generic blog posts disconnected from actual customer intent is one of the most common local SEO mistakes. Publishing a post titled “Tips for Choosing a Tradie” does nothing for a concreting business in Coomera. Publishing a detailed guide on soil and drainage conditions specific to new estates in the northern Gold Coast corridor, on the other hand, answers a real question that real customers are searching. Specificity earns rankings. It also holds readers on the page long enough to actually matter for bounce rate and engagement signals.

    Backlinks From Local Sources Signal Trust

    National SEO conversations obsess over backlink quantity. For local search, a handful of genuinely relevant local links carry outsized weight. A mention in a Gold Coast publication, a link from a local business association, or a feature on a suburb-specific community website communicates something to a search algorithm that hundreds of irrelevant directory submissions simply cannot. It signals that the business is a legitimate, embedded part of the local community. That signal is harder to fake and harder to ignore.
